Job Summary

SG Cares is a national movement to build a caring and inclusive home for all, where Singaporeans can show care and consideration to others. In 2018, pilot studies on how to grow more volunteers and better channel their efforts to areas where they can have greater impact in the neighbourhood were established in two towns.

The pilots showed that a dedicated effort at the local‑level to grow the volunteer pool, build their capabilities, and coordinate the demand and supply of volunteers, was important to make a sustained impact. Hence, MCCY will be partnering community groups to establish Volunteer Centres (VC) for volunteer matching, deployment and training in the towns.

The VC will help:

  • build volunteer management capabilities;
  • broker sustained partnerships between volunteering groups; and
  • work with service providers to meet their needs for volunteers
